About methyl N-(phenylcarbamoyl)carbamate

methyl N-(phenylcarbamoyl)carbamate (PubChem CID 13097714) has the molecular formula C9H10N2O3 and a molecular weight of 194.19 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is methyl N-(phenylcarbamoyl)carbamate.
